PHP简介
PHP是一种流行的Web编程语言,适用于动态Web页面的开发。最初由Rasmus Lerdorf于1994年发明,现在是开源软件社区中的一种标准技术。PHP让网站开发变得更加容易和高效,并在所有大小型公司中得到广泛应用。
PHP基础知识
为了理解如何使用PHP,您需要掌握一些基础知识。首先是如何编写代码:PHP使用一种类似于C语言的语法。它是一种解释性语言,这意味着您无需编译代码,只需在Web服务器上运行即可。与静态网页相比,动态PHP页面允许从服务器检索和显示数据,并根据所需内容自动生成HTML。
与数据库的交互
PHP的一个强大之处是可以轻松与数据库进行交互,以存储和检索数据。为此,您需要安装并配置适合您的Web服务器的数据库管理系统(DBMS),例如MySQL。接下来,您需要使用PHP编写代码以执行与数据库的交互操作。这可能包括创建和查询数据库,插入和更新数据等。
网站功能开发
一旦了解了PHP基础知识并与数据库进行了交互,您可以开始构建功能强大的Web应用程序。这可能包括用户登录和身份验证、快速搜索和过滤、购物车和付款系统等。
开发工具
为方便编写代码和管理项目,您需要适合您的开发工具。一些流行的PHP开发工具包括:
- PHPStorm:流行的商业PHP IDE。
- Aptana Studio:免费的PHP IDE。
- Sublime Text:流行的文本编辑器,通过插件支持PHP编程。
- Atom:另一个流行的开源文本编辑器,具有可自定义的界面。
最佳实践
建议您遵循一些最佳实践以确保您的PHP代码易于使用和维护。这些可能包括:
- 使用面向对象编程(OOP):OOP提供了更好的代码组织和可重用性。
- 使用命名空间:命名空间有助于避免对代码库中的不同部分进行命名冲突。
- 避免在PHP代码中直接使用SQL:这可降低安全性和可维护性,最好使用ORM(对象关系映射)库。
- 使用PHP框架:PHP框架可帮助您将代码分解为组件,使其易于重用和修改。
总结
PHP是一种强大和流行的Web编程语言,但要在应用程序中使用它,您需要掌握一些基础知识。这包括与数据库的交互、开发工具和最佳实践等方面。通过运用现代的编写实践和工具,您可以建立出令人印象深刻的Web应用程序。